Who can carry out teeth
whitening?
New laws mean that ONLYDENTISTS can offer teethwhitening using peroxide. It is illegal for anyone other than a dentist (e.g., beauticians,hairdressers, or salon staff) towhiten teeth using peroxide.
The products you can buy online or from the shops are often notclear about exactly what theycontain so it’s very difficult to know if they are safe to use. Also, they won’t produce thesame results you can expect by visiting your dentist.
Dentist-prescribed teethwhitening using the tray system isin most cases very predictable andsuccessful. If your teeth are likelyto be more difficult to treat, yourdentist will inform you in advance.
A low but highly effectiveconcentration of hydrogenperoxide (bleach) is applied toyour teeth using specially madetrays that properly fit aroundyour teeth.
Your dentist can estimate froma chart what improvement incolour you’re likely to achieve.He/she will also give you anidea of how long treatment willtake – usually up to two weeks.

If you have any concerns about the possibility of illegal practice, contact the IrishMedicines Board (IMB) at [email protected]. The IMB’s role is the protection ofthe public and they will follow up any complaint made to them.
If carried out by a dentist,whitening is perfectly safe. Basedon a thorough examination ofyour mouth, and their knowledgeof your oral health, your dentistwill discuss your options, decide if teeth whitening is right for you.

How long doeswhitening last?
Dentist-prescribed teethwhitening remains stable overtime, with little reduction inwhiteness. A top-up after one totwo years will very quickly restoreany slight loss of colour.
